What GPTZero is and why you might want to cancel

GPTZero is an online tool that analyses text to determine whether it was generated by artificial intelligence or written by a human. The service works through the GPTZero website and mobile apps on both iOS and Android, making it accessible wherever you work.

The platform offers free access with limited scans, plus paid plans that unlock higher word-count allowances, advanced plagiarism detection, grammar checking, and detailed AI content reports. You might choose GPTZero to verify student essays, check content for your business, or audit your own writing before publication.

However, if you no longer need AI detection, find the pricing too steep for your use case, or prefer a competitor's features, cancelling your subscription is straightforward once you know where to look. Where GPTZero charges you

Your subscription may bill directly through the GPTZero website at gptzero.me, or it may charge through Apple's App Store (iOS) or Google Play (Android) if you downloaded the mobile app. Each billing channel has its own cancellation process, and that's where most people get stuck. Why annual plans make cancellation tricky

If you paid for a full year upfront, your account will automatically renew on the anniversary of your purchase unless you cancel beforehand. How to cancel GPTZero on the website

If you subscribed directly through gptzero.me, follow these steps to cancel your paid plan.

Step-by-step cancellation via the GPTZero website

  1. Open your web browser and go to gptzero.me.
    • If you are not already logged in, enter your email address and password.
    • If you forget your password, click the "Forgot password" link and follow the recovery email.
  2. Navigate to your account settings or billing section.
    • Look for a "My Account," "Billing," "Subscriptions," or "Plans" link, usually in the top right corner or in a dropdown menu.
    • If you cannot find it immediately, try scrolling to the footer for a "Settings" link.
  3. Locate your active subscription in the list.
    • You may see multiple past invoices or billing records; find the one marked "Active" or "Current."
    • Note the renewal date so you understand when your access will end.
  4. Click "Cancel subscription" or "Manage plan" next to your active plan.
    • The button label may vary slightly depending on your account age or plan type.
    • Do not click "Upgrade" or "Change plan" unless you want to switch tiers instead of cancelling.
  5. Confirm your cancellation when prompted.
    • GPTZero may ask why you are cancelling or offer a discount to keep you as a customer. You are under no obligation to accept a discount or provide feedback.
    • Once you confirm, the system will display a cancellation confirmation message.
  6. Screenshot or email yourself the confirmation page for your records.
    • Write down the cancellation date, your plan type, and the final access date so you remember when your paid features expire.
    • Check your email inbox for a cancellation confirmation message from GPTZero within a few minutes.

What happens to your access after cancellation

Your paid plan features remain active until the end of your current billing cycle. If your renewal date is 15 November and you cancel on 1 November, you can still use Premium features until 15 November at midnight (NZ time). After that date, your account automatically drops to the free tier, and you lose access to advanced plagiarism scanning, high word counts, and grammar checking.

Pro tip: If you have important AI detection reports to save, export them to PDF or download them before your access ends. GPTZero's data retention policies are not transparent, and there is no guarantee your reports will remain accessible after downgrade.

How to cancel GPTZero on apple app store

If you subscribed to GPTZero through your iPhone or iPad, you cancel directly in Apple's ecosystem, not through the GPTZero app itself.

Cancelling your iOS subscription

  1. On your iPhone or iPad, open the Settings app.
    • Look for the grey gear icon on your home screen.
    • If you use Face ID or Touch ID, you may see "Settings" in your dock or app library.
  2. Tap your Apple ID name at the top of the Settings menu.
    • You will see your profile photo (or initials) and email address.
    • If you have multiple Apple IDs, make sure you tap the correct one.
  3. Select "Subscriptions" from the list.
    • You may see "Media & Purchases" first; scroll down to find "Subscriptions."
    • This option shows all active and past subscriptions across the App Store.
  4. Find "GPTZero" in your active subscriptions list.
    • If you see multiple entries, check the renewal date to find the active one.
    • Inactive or expired subscriptions appear greyed out or under "Expired Subscriptions."
  5. Tap the GPTZero subscription entry.
    • A details page will show your plan name, next billing date, and cancellation option.
    • Do not tap "Upgrade" or "Change plan" unless you want to switch subscription tiers.
  6. Tap "Cancel Subscription" at the bottom of the screen.
    • Apple will ask you to confirm your decision and may show you a retention offer or discount.
    • Ignore the discount offer if you are certain you want to cancel.
  7. Confirm cancellation by tapping "Confirm" in the final popup.
    • Your iOS subscription to GPTZero is now cancelled and will not renew.
    • You will receive an email confirmation from Apple within minutes.

IOS access after cancellation

You keep full access to paid GPTZero features until your current billing period ends. If you cancel mid-month, you still have until the same day next month (or the last day of February if your renewal is on 31st). After that date, the app reverts to free-tier functionality, and you cannot access Premium scans or high word-count limits.

Warning: Deleting the GPTZero app from your phone does NOT cancel your subscription. You must follow the steps above in Settings to stop charges. Many users delete the app and think they have cancelled, only to discover charges continue on their next billing date.

How to cancel GPTZero on google play

Android users who subscribed through Google Play cancel via the Google Play Store app or website, not within GPTZero itself.

Cancelling your android subscription

  1. On your Android phone or tablet, open Google Play Store.
    • Tap the coloured play icon on your home screen or in your app drawer.
    • If you cannot find it, search "Google Play Store" in your launcher.
  2. Tap your profile icon in the top right corner (usually a photo or circle with your initial).
    • A dropdown menu will appear with account options.
    • Do not confuse this with the settings gear icon.
  3. Select "Manage subscriptions" or "Subscriptions" from the menu.
    • This shows all active and past subscriptions linked to your Google account.
    • You may need to scroll down to find the option if your menu is long.
  4. Find "GPTZero" in the list of active subscriptions.
    • Inactive or cancelled subscriptions appear under "Expired" or "Ended."
    • Tap the GPTZero entry to open its subscription details.
  5. Tap "Cancel subscription" or "Manage" at the bottom of the screen.
    • Google will show your plan details, next billing date, and cancellation option.
    • Some versions of Google Play show a blue "Cancel" button directly on this page.
  6. Confirm your cancellation when prompted.
    • Google may ask why you are cancelling or offer a discount or loyalty reward.
    • You do not need to engage with these offers; simply confirm cancellation.
  7. Check your email for a cancellation confirmation from Google Play within minutes.
    • Save this email and screenshot the confirmation page as proof of cancellation.
    • Your Android subscription to GPTZero will not renew on the next billing date.

Android access after cancellation

Like Apple, Google Play allows you to use GPTZero's paid features until the end of your current billing month. After your renewal date passes, the app downgrades to free tier, and Premium scans are blocked.

Pro tip: If you own multiple Android devices and subscribed on more than one phone, check Google Play's Manage Subscriptions page for each device or Google account. You may have accidentally set up duplicate subscriptions.

Your consumer rights and what you can do if GPTZero refuses to help

As a consumer in New Zealand, you are protected by the Consumer Guarantees Act 1993 and the Fair Trading Act 1986.

Consumer protections that apply to GPTZero

GPTZero must supply services to you that are of acceptable quality and fit for purpose. If the service does not detect AI content accurately, crashes frequently, or fails to match the features described on their website, you have grounds to request a refund or remediation under the Consumer Guarantees Act, even if GPTZero's standard terms say "no refunds."

Additionally, if GPTZero continues to charge you after you cancel, or if they deliberately hide the cancellation process to trap you in automatic renewal, this breaches the Fair Trading Act's prohibition on unfair contract terms and misleading conduct.

Steps to take if GPTZero ignores your cancellation request

  1. Email GPTZero's support team with proof of your cancellation attempt.
    • Include screenshots of your account settings, confirmation emails, and billing records.
    • Request written confirmation that your subscription is cancelled and explain any unexpected charges.
  2. If GPTZero does not respond within 5 business days, escalate to the Commerce Commission.
    • Visit commissionerregistry.org.nz to report unfair billing practices.
    • The Commerce Commission handles complaints about misleading or deceptive conduct in New Zealand.
  3. Request a chargeback through your bank if you believe the charges are unauthorised.
    • Your bank can reverse the transaction if you prove you cancelled in good faith.
    • Keep all cancellation confirmations and email correspondence for your dispute file.

Will you get a refund after cancellation

This is where many users encounter disappointment, so let's be honest about what to expect.

GPTZero's official refund policy

GPTZero's Terms of Use state that all subscription purchases made via the website are non-refundable once the billing cycle begins. If you paid for a month or year, that money is yours to keep only through the end of that cycle. After cancellation, you lose paid access, but you do not receive a cash refund for the remaining unused time.

This policy is standard across SaaS (software-as-a-service) platforms, though it does not make it feel fair if you cancel after one day of use.

Exceptions and special circumstances

If you subscribed through Apple App Store or Google Play, you may have a stronger case for a refund. Apple and Google allow refunds within 48 hours of purchase for any reason, and up to 30 days for defective services. Contact Apple or Google Support directly with proof that the service did not meet the advertised features, and they may grant you a full or partial refund without GPTZero's permission.

Additionally, under New Zealand's Consumer Guarantees Act, if GPTZero's service is not of acceptable quality or does not match its description, you can demand a refund regardless of the "non-refundable" terms. For example, if GPTZero claims 99.9% AI detection accuracy but consistently misses obvious AI content, you have a legal basis to request money back. The onus is on GPTZero to prove the service is working as advertised.

Common mistakes people make when cancelling GPTZero

Cancellation seems simple until you make a mistake and discover charges still appearing on your card weeks later.

Deleting the app is not the same as cancelling

Thousands of users delete the GPTZero app from their phone and assume their subscription is gone. The app is just an interface; your subscription lives in Apple's ecosystem or Google's system. Deleting the app only removes it from your home screen. Your payment method is still on file, and charges continue. Stopee cannot emphasise this enough: uninstalling the app does nothing.

Confusing cancellation date with access end date

When you cancel, your access continues until the end of your current billing period. Many users cancel and expect immediate loss of Premium features, then panic when they can still scan documents the next day. This is normal. Your paid plan ends on the next renewal date, not on the cancellation date itself. Note both dates separately so you do not get confused.

Not saving your confirmation

The moment you see a cancellation confirmation, screenshot it or forward the confirmation email to yourself or a backup account. If a dispute arises later, you have proof of when and how you cancelled. Without this proof, your bank or the Commerce Commission will side with GPTZero because they have automated records of your subscription being active.

Cancelling during a promotional period and losing the discount retroactively

Some users sign up for a discounted trial or promotional rate, then cancel only to discover they are being billed at the full regular price for the remainder of that term. Read your email confirmation when you first subscribe so you understand whether you locked in a permanent discount or just a temporary promotional rate. If unsure, email GPTZero's support team before cancelling to confirm your pricing terms.

What to do after you cancel GPTZero

Cancellation is not the end; the next 30 days are crucial to making sure the cancellation sticks.

Monitor your bank account and email

Check your bank statement or credit card activity for the next month to ensure no charges appear after your renewal date. If a charge does show up after you cancelled, take a screenshot immediately and contact your bank to dispute it. Most banks allow disputes within 90 days, so you have time, but acting fast strengthens your case.

Additionally, watch your email for any renewal reminders or billing notifications from GPTZero. If you receive a "Your subscription has renewed" email when you cancelled, forward it to your bank as proof of the error.
